SIP trunking is an internet-based phone system that provides several benefits over traditional ISDN lines. It allows calls to be made over the internet rather than physical phone lines, saving on maintenance and permitting flexibility to add or remove lines as needed. Key benefits include lower costs since only internet access is needed rather than leasing phone lines, the ability to make calls from any location, and issues being fixed remotely without service fees. While bandwidth and security require consideration, firewalls can protect networks, and SIP trunking is more reliable and offers more options than ISDN. Overall SIP trunking is more flexible, cost effective, and provides savings for businesses.
